Suggest Treatment For Low Grade Fever And Vomiting In A 8 Year Old Child
My daughter is 8 1/2. She has been complaining of being achy, has a low fever. She vomited a little bit ago and now her legs are shaking uncontrollably. She does complain of stuffy nose. And combined of a bad headache off and on today. She said it was the worst she has ever had. It comes and goes. My son and I had an achy illness a couple weeks ago. Only lasted 24 hours and followed by a cold. Wondering if she could have the same thing or something more serious.
Hi...Thank you for consulting in Health Care magic. Fever of few days without any localizing signs could as well a viral illness. Usually rather than fever, what is more important is the activity of the child, in between 2 fever episodes on the same day. If the kid is active and playing around when there is no fever, it is probably viral illness and it doesn't require antibiotics at all. Once viral fever comes it will there for 4-7 days. So do not worry about duration if the kid is active. Paracetamol can be given in the dose of 15mg/kg/dose (maximum ceiling dose of 500mg) every 4-6th hourly that too only if fever is more than 100F. I suggest not using combination medicines for fever, especially with Paracetamol. Regards - Dr. Sumanth
